Answer
For teak before oil, use 180 then 220. Start with 120 only on weathered or rough areas.
Why it happens
Teak is dense and oily, so sanding dust and uneven scratch patterns can affect the final look.
Recommended grit
Use 180 then 220 before oil. For refinishing weathered teak, start with 120 only where needed.
Wet or dry
Dry.
Success check
The teak has an even color and smooth feel before oiling.
What to do
- Clean the teak surface first.
- Use 120 only on weathered or rough areas.
- Sand through 180 and 220.
- Remove dust thoroughly before applying oil.
Avoid: Do not oil over sanding dust or grey oxidized wood.
